Bridal Jewelry
The theme of your wedding and the style of wedding dress will determine the type of bridal jewellery you wear on your big day. For brides who have chosen a classic and traditional white wedding, elegant bridal jewellery such as a beautiful tennis bracelet is an ideal choice. When considering a necklace for your wedding day, think about the neckline of your wedding dress and decide upon the style that matches your other bridal jewellery. Typically brides choose to wear complimentary jewellery, including earrings, a necklace, and a bracelet.

Veils
Don’t feel that you have to be throwing a big traditional wedding in order to wear a veil! Plenty of brides have hosted alternative weddings and rocked the veil. Thankfully, veils come in all different shapes and sizes, so there’s always going to be something that suits your personality and wedding aesthetic. 50’s inspired brides may love birdcage veils, whereas those brides that are looking for a more bohemian look may consider lace or beaded veils.
Hair Pieces
If you decide against wearing a veil, you’re going to want to wear something elegant in your hair to add a little something special. Hair pieces aren’t just limited to headbands and tiaras – there are lots of options available, so there’s always something to complement your hairstyle and wedding theme. Consider flower crowns, hair wraps, hair vines, and hair combs.
Dazzling Bridal Belts
Bridal belts are self-tying sashes that typically have a soft base and provide a little sparkle to the bride’s wedding dress, helping to create a statement look that is unforgettable. The underside of bridal belts is soft to ensure that it does not mark or damage the wedding dress, and the design usually includes some sort of ornamentation. Bridal belts can completely transform a dress, therefore brides with simple dresses often choose accessories with a bridal belt to create a truly showstopping look. Of course, as well as adding to the aesthetics of the wedding dress, the bridal belt also helps to flatter the bride’s figure.
A Small Clutch Bag With An Emergency Kit
Lastly, a small clutch with an emergency wedding night kit is absolutely essential! Match the clutch to your wedding dress and stock up on useful items, such as blister plasters and tissues. A small clutch bag is also a great place to keep your phone and other essential items that you want to have on your person when you’re partying the night away.
